Top Zillow Web Scrapers of 2026
Zillow is one of the most popular real estate platforms in the US, packed with property listings, price estimates, rental data, and neighborhood insights. Whether you’re buying, selling, or just browsing out of curiosity, it’s all there in one place. But once you try working with that data at scale – analyzing trends, tracking prices, or building your own datasets – you’ll quickly run into limitations. That’s where dedicated scraping tools come in. In this article, we reviewed the best Zillow scrapers currently available on the market.
Top Zillow Scrapers of 2026:
1. Decodo (formerly Smartproxy) – Overall best Zillow scraper.
2. Zyte API – The fastest Zillow scraper.
3. Oxylabs – Performant scraper with robust infrastructure.
4. NetNut – Rapid scraper with some trade-offs
5. ScrapingBee – Convenient and reliable Zillow scraper.
What is Zillow Scraping?
Zillow scraping is simply a way to collect real estate data from Zillow without clicking through listings one by one like it’s 2009. You can pull information like listing prices, rent estimates, property details, and location data – and turn it into something you can actually analyze.
Now, just because the data is visible doesn’t mean you can go and storm it out. Zillow still has rules and scraping has to be done ethically. You will need to stay within their terms of service, respect their robots.txt, and avoid doing anything that could land you in legal trouble.
So, the data is there, but how you access and use it still matters.
What Data Can You Scrape from Zillow?
Zillow is a layered dataset of the housing market, updated in near real time. Depending on what you’re after, there’s plenty you can pull out of it. Some of the most commonly scraped data points include:
- Property prices. Listing prices, sold house prices, and rent estimates can be used to track market movements or compare areas.
- Property characteristics. You can scrape the basics that define a listing, including square footage, number of bedrooms and bathrooms, property type and lot size.
- Zestimate. Zillow have their own valuation model, often debated but still widely used for quick comparisons.
- Listing status. Whether a property is for sale, pending, recently sold, or off-market. Useful for tracking supply and demand.
- Location details. Addresses, ZIP codes, neighborhoods, and sometimes nearby schools or points of interest.
- Price history. Changes in listing price over time, which can reveal trends or seller behavior.
- Agent information. Names and agencies associated with listings, when available.
- Descriptions and images. Listing text and photos that give more context to the property.
Beyond individual listings, you can also scrape broader datasets – for example, entire neighborhoods, city-wide listings, rental markets, or newly listed properties over time.
Note: not every field is equally accessible. Some data is loaded dynamically, and consistency can vary depending on location and listing type.
How did Zillow scrapers perform in our research?
The rankings in this list are based on how each provider performed in our 2025 scraper API research. We tested them on Zillow under real conditions, measuring success rates and response times at a steady rate of two requests per second.
To ensure consistent results, we used each tool’s recommended setup for handling dynamic content. In some cases, that included enabling JavaScript rendering or using higher-quality proxy pools. To compare pricing, we also estimated a unified CPM (cost per 1,000 requests) based on a $500 usage scenario.
Zillow turned out to be one of the easier targets to unblock. This isn’t a site where everything breaks after three requests – you don’t need to bring a tank to a knife fight. The average success rate reached 97.85% at 2 requests per second, and none of the tested APIs fell below 80%. In other words, most tools were able to access the site reliably – the actual differences came down to speed, consistency, and pricing.
| Provider | Success rate | Response time | CPM at $500 |
| Decodo | 99.98% | 3.35 s | $1.10 |
| Zyte | 100% | 1.11 s | $1.02 |
| Oxylabs | 99.98% | 3.40 s | $1.15 |
| NetNut | 99.87% | 2.77 s | $1.50 |
| ScrapingBee | 99.35% | 19.71s | $5.99 |
The Top Zillow Scrapers
1. Decodo (formerly Smartproxy)
Overall best Zillow scraper.
Try 100 MB for free.

Available tools:
General-purpose API
- Integration: API (real-time or async), SDK, or MCP
- Data parsing: manual or AI-generated parsing instructions
- Locations: 150+
- Pricing model: credits
- Pricing starts at: $19/mo for up to 38K requests
- Free trial: $1 credit, 14-day refund
Decodo’s Web Scraping API is a general-purpose tool – and more than enough for a target like Zillow.
In practice, using Decodo is a straightforward process. You can send a Zillow URL and get raw HTML back, or use its AI-powered parser to extract structured data like prices, property details, or listing status. If you don’t feel like digging through Zillow’s layout yourself, letting the parser do the work is usually the better call.
The infrastructure provides multiple integration methods – real-time and asynchronous requests, SDKs, and even MCP for agent-based workflows. Output formats include HTML, JSON, CSV, Markdown, and more, so you can shape the data however you need.
Performance-wise, Decodo handled Zillow almost effortlessly. It achieved a 99.98% success rate with an average response time of 3.35 seconds, putting it among the most reliable options in our tests. Pricing is credit-based, which works in your favor here. Requests tend to stay relatively cheap, though enabling JavaScript rendering to fully load listing data will increase the cost.
For more information and performance tests, read our Decodo review.
2. Zyte
The fastest Zillow scraper.

Available tools:
General-purpose API
- Integration:API (real-time), proxy, or SDK
- Data parsing: AI-extraction parser
- Locations: 150+ locations with country-level targeting
- Pricing model: pay as you go, subscription
- Starting price: $0.13 for 1k HTTPS responses, $1.01 for 1k browser-rendered responses
- Free trial: $5 platform credits for 30 days
Zyte, one of the more experienced scraping providers in the industry, The generic scraper comes packed with features you’d normally need for tougher targets – which makes Zillow a relatively easy job.
Its API handles proxies, retries, and ban detection on its own, so you can just point it at a Zillow page and let it do its thing. More importantly, Zyte offers AI-assisted data extraction, which can turn raw Zillow pages into structured data without manually defining selectors. For a site with dynamic layouts, that can save a lot of setup time.
Performance-wise, Zyte was the fastest tool we tested. It achieved a 99.98% success rate with an average response time of 1.11 seconds, making it the quickest option in the lineup.
Pricing is usage-based and depends on what features you enable. For simpler requests, prices can start from around $0.13 per 1,000 responses, while browser-rendered requests can go above $1 per 1,000. In practice, Zillow scraping usually sits closer to the lower end – unless you rely heavily on full rendering or AI extraction.
For more information and performance tests, read our Zyte review.
3. Oxylabs
Performant scraper with robust infrastructure.
Use the code Discount30 to get 30% off.

Available tools:
General-purpose API with a dedicated endpoint for Zillow search results
- Integration: API (real-time or async), proxy, MCP
- Data parsing: manual instructions (XPath, CSS, Regex) with savable presets, dedicated endpoint, AI parser generator
- Locations: 150+
- Pricing model: subscription; based on successful requests
- Pricing starts at: $49/mo for up to 98K requests
- Free trial: 7-day trial with 2K results
Oxylabs is one of the premium players in the scraping space, and its Web Scraper API brings pretty much everything you’d expect – strong infrastructure, flexible configuration, and AI-assisted tooling.
It also offers a dedicated Zillow endpoint, which simplifies the whole process. Instead of scanning the site’s structure yourself, you can query listings directly and get structured results with minimal setup. When it comes to parsing, you can either define selectors manually or use OxyCopilot to generate extraction logic from natural language.
Oxylabs delivered excellent results in our tests. It achieved a 99.98% success rate with an average response time of 3.40 seconds, so you can be certain about reliable service.
While Oxylabs sits on the higher end price-wise, it remains relatively affordable for the value it offers. There are regular and enterprise plans to fit different needs, though the lack of a pay-as-you-go option may be a drawback for more flexible use cases.
For more information and performance tests, read our Oxylabs review.
4. NetNut
Rapid scraper with some trade-offs.

Available tools:
Web Unblocker
- Integration: API (real-time or async), proxy
- Data parsing: not available
- Locations: 150+
- Pricing model: subscription; based on successful requests
- Pricing starts at: $99/mo for 66K results
- Free trial: 7 days for companies
NetNut is an established provider, best known for its proxies, but its Website Unblocker doubles as a capable scraping tool. It comes with a variety of features like JavaScript rendering, browser header customization, and multiple location options.
It handled Zillow without issues, reaching a commendable 99.87% success rate with an average response time of 2.77 seconds, overtaking bigger sharks in the scraping market.
The trade-off is flexibility. Targeting is limited to the country level, and there’s no built-in parser, so you’ll need to handle data extraction yourself.
Pricing starts at around $99/month, placing it on the higher end compared to some API-based tools. While you’re paying for strong infrastructure and reliability, this can feel a bit excessive for an easier target like Zillow.
For more information and performance tests, read our NetNut review.
5. ScrapingBee
Convenient and reliable Zillow scraper.

Available tools:
General-purpose API
- Integration: API (real-time), proxy, SDK, MCP
- Data parsing: manual or AI-generated parsing instructions
- Locations: 195+ locations with country-level targeting
- Pricing model: subscription based on API credits (5 credits = 1 request)
- Pricing starts at: $49/mo for 250K credits
- Free trial: 1K free API calls
ScrapingBee excels in simplicity, which is one of the reasons it made this list. Its API is easy to use, but still comes with enough features to handle sites like Zillow without much trouble.
You can send a request and get the page content, or use its AI Web Scraping features to extract structured data without touching CSS selectors or XPath. For Zillow listings, that can save a fair bit of setup time. Since the target isn’t particularly demanding, ScrapingBee’s lighter setup works in its favor.
In our tests, ScrapingBee performed well, even if it lagged behind the top performers in terms of response time. Still, it gets the job done without much friction – which is kind of the whole point.
Pricing is credit-based. Simple requests are cheap, but costs increase if you enable JavaScript rendering or premium proxies. There’s also a free trial with 1,000 credits if you want to try it out.
For more information and performance tests, read our ScrapingBee review.
Frequently Asked Questions About Zillow Scrapers
Short answer: usually yes. Longer answer: yes, if you do it ethically.
Zillow data is publicly accessible, which makes scraping it generally legal. But that doesn’t mean you can go full chaos mode. You still need to respect their terms of service, follow robots.txt, and avoid doing anything abusive or shady. Just because you can doesn’t mean you should spam 1,000 requests per second.
You can use an IP database like IP2Location. It allows up to 200 free IP checks per day. Look for “Usage Type” and “Proxy Type” fields.
Depends on what you care about. If you want speed, Zyte was the fastest in our tests. If you prefer something straightforward and flexible, Decodo and ScrapingBee are easy to work with. And if you want a more enterprise-grade setup with a dedicated Zillow endpoint, Oxylabs is hard to beat.
Proxy geek and developer.
- April 17, 2026